Grasping Pinterest SEO: The Basics

Even though numerous users see Pinterest largely as a visual discovery platform, mastering Pinterest SEO is vital for enhancing visibility and engagement. Pinterest works much like a search engine, where optimized content can significantly increase a user's reach. The platform depends on algorithms that prioritize relevant and high-quality pins, making it vital for creators to adopt effective SEO practices.

Essential components of Pinterest SEO include enhancing pin descriptions, utilizing alt text, and identifying the right image formats. Captivating titles and clear, informative descriptions assist users swiftly grasp the content's value. In addition, developing visually appealing pins formatted for Pinterest's vertical format can seize user attention.

Using boards effectively, organizing content into relevant categories, and maintaining a consistent posting schedule also enhance improved SEO performance. By embracing these foundational aspects of Pinterest SEO, users can create a more impactful presence and increase their chances of attracting a larger audience.

Keyword Research: Discovering the Right Terms

Strategic keyword research is vital for improving Pinterest visibility and engagement. This process involves identifying the specific terms and phrases that potential users are searching for on the platform. By utilizing tools such as Pinterest's search bar, users can discover trending keywords and related searches, which provide information into audience interests.

Examining competitor accounts and top-performing pins also yields valuable data, showing which keywords drive traffic. It is vital to emphasize long-tail keywords, as these typically have decreased competition and address niche markets, enhancing the potential of engagement.

Furthermore, including timely and popular keywords can even more improve visibility, aligning content with present interests. By focusing on relevant keywords and integrating them organically into pin descriptions, titles, and boards, users can greatly enhance their potential of reaching a wider audience. On the whole, effective keyword research establishes the foundation for a winning Pinterest strategy.

Board Management Techniques

Proper board arrangement is vital for maximizing a Pinterest profile's reach. A thoughtfully arranged board arrangement not only enhances user experience but also increases discoverability. It is vital to organize boards thematically, ensuring each corresponds to the overall brand message. Placing popular topics at the top of the profile can gain more followers. Additionally, incorporating relevant keywords in board titles and descriptions improves search visibility. Frequently updating boards with fresh content keeps the profile dynamic and engaging. Users should also consider creating secret boards for testing new strategies without public scrutiny. Ultimately, strategic board organization can substantially boost engagement and traffic, ultimately leading to a more successful Pinterest strategy.

Keyword Enhancement Methods

A properly optimized pin description can substantially boost visibility on Pinterest, attracting more users and enhancing engagement. Successful keyword optimization involves identifying appropriate terms that resonate with the target audience. Leveraging tools like Pinterest Trends and Google Keyword Planner can help with discovering high-performing keywords associated with specific niches. It is essential to integrate these keywords naturally within the pin description, guaranteeing they fit seamlessly into the content. Additionally, using long-tail keywords can help target more specific searches, increasing the likelihood of reaching interested users. By strategically placing keywords in the first few lines of the description, creators can maximize their chances of appearing in search results, ultimately producing higher traffic and fostering greater interaction with their pins.

Leveraging Rich Pins for Improved Engagement

Adding Rich Pins into a Pinterest marketing plan can significantly enhance user engagement and interaction. Rich Pins deliver additional information directly on the pin itself, improving the user experience and encouraging more clicks. There are three types of Rich Pins: Product, Article, and Recipe, each designed to deliver relevant data. For instance, Product Pins show real-time pricing and availability, making them particularly valuable for e-commerce brands. Article Pins provide detailed descriptions and authorship, working to increase traffic to blog posts. Recipe Pins provide cooking times, ingredients, and serving sizes, attracting food enthusiasts. By leveraging these features, businesses can create a more interactive and informative experience, resulting in higher engagement rates. Rich Pins not only make content more discoverable but also establish credibility and trustworthiness. Overall, using Rich Pins can tremendously strengthen a brand's presence on Pinterest, driving more traffic and fostering a loyal audience.

Assessing Your Performance: Adjusting Your Strategy

A detailed analysis of performance metrics is critical for enhancing a Pinterest strategy. By reviewing key indicators such as impressions, saves, and click-through rates, marketers can determine which types of content resonate most with their audience. Regularly reviewing these metrics permits the identification of trends and patterns, facilitating informed adjustments to posting schedules and content.

Incorporating analytics tools can streamline this process, delivering more comprehensive insights into audience demographics and engagement levels. If specific pins consistently outperform others, it may indicate a need to develop related content or optimize underperforming pins. Moreover, modifying keywords and descriptions based on search trends can even more enhance visibility.

Eventually, this iterative process of performance analysis cultivates a responsive strategy that adapts with audience preferences, in the end driving enhanced traffic and engagement on Pinterest. The ability to pivot based on data secures a competitive edge in the dynamic landscape of social media marketing.
